Konu Araçları | Seçenekler: | Gösterim Stili
Tarih
19/01/2012 12:23
Konu Sahibi
kursad05
Yorumlar
9
Okunma
2963
Konuyu Oyla:
  • Derecelendirme: 3/5 - 1 oy
  • 5
  • 4
  • 3
  • 2
  • 1

Derecelendirme: 3/5 - 1 oy
Kullanici Avatari

kursad05

Kendi halinde...
Aktif Üye
KÜ.... KA....
 40
99
12/02/2009
0
Amasya
Ofis 2013 64 Bit
03/05/2018,15:23
Çözüldü 
Değerli üstatlarım,
Ben okulda kullanmak üzere ücret onayı hazırlıyorum. Daha doğrusu hazırladım. Vba dan formülleri girdim. İlgili kutuların ve onay kutuların "güncelleştirme sonrasında" kısmına kodları oluşturdum. Form(Form Adı=Ücret Onayı alt2) içinse "Geçerli Olduğunda" kısmına kodları oluşturdum. Verileri girdiğim zaman veya değiştirdiğim zaman ilgili onay kutuları duruma göre anında güncelleniyor ancak değer yazması ve hesap yapması gereken kutular işlem yapmıyor. Bunun için forma YENİLE düğmesi de ekledim. Lakin yine hesaplama yapmıyor. Taki yaptığım kayıtları tek tek üzerlerine tıklayınca verileri hesalıyor. Hesaplama ve istenen veriyi yazm noktasında sıkıntı yok. Sıkıntı, bu işlemi veri girerken yapmaması. Örneklerde veri girişi yaptım ne demek istediğimi her bir satıra fare ile tıklayınca daha iyi anlarsınız. Yardımlarınız için şimdiden teşekkürler.

Ek Dosyalar
ücretonayı2003.rar
[139.32 KB]

Ek Dosyalar
ücretonayı2010.rar
[320.05 KB]


Gün gelecek herkes beni ve Access'i anlayacak!!!

Kullanici Avatari

ozanakkaya

sledgeab
Kurucu
OZ.... AK....
 40
10.963
29/01/2008
Denizli
Memur
Ofis 2010 32 Bit
Bugün,00:25
Çözüldü 
Onay kutularının olmadığını farzedersek, hesaplamanın neye göre yapılacağını kısaca anlatır mısınız ?


"Boş Örnek Eklerim, Yapıp Verirler" demeyin, örneğinizi hazırlayın.
Komplike kod talebiniz var ise İletişim bağlantısından bize ulaşın. 
Cebelleşmezsen Öğrenemezsin. 

Kullanici Avatari

kursad05

Kendi halinde...
Aktif Üye
KÜ.... KA....
 40
99
12/02/2009
0
Amasya
Ofis 2013 64 Bit
03/05/2018,15:23
Çözüldü 
(19/01/2012, 19:57)sledgeab Adlı Kullanıcıdan Alıntı: Onay kutularının olmadığını farzedersek, hesaplamanın neye göre yapılacağını kısaca anlatır mısınız ?

Tabi ki hocam.
Öncelikle [a]=[c] ve [b]=[ç] olacak.
j= ç + d + e + f + g + ğ + h + ı + i (bu da son toplam olacak)

Onun haricinde geri kalan hesaplamayı ekteki excel(2003) dosyasında tablo halinde gösterdim.
En kısa şekilde ancak böyle anlattım hocam.
Ek Dosyalar
hesaplama.xls
[29 KB]


Gün gelecek herkes beni ve Access'i anlayacak!!!

Kullanici Avatari

ozanakkaya

sledgeab
Kurucu
OZ.... AK....
 40
10.963
29/01/2008
Denizli
Memur
Ofis 2010 32 Bit
Bugün,00:25
Çözüldü 
Tüm kodları silip aşağıdaki kodu vb sayfasına ekleyin.

Visual Basic Code
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
Sub Hesapla()
Select Case Me.Ünvan.Value
Case "Okul Müdürü"
	Me.a.Value = "0"
	Me.d.Value = "20"
	Me.f.Value = "0"
	Me.g.Value = "0"
	Me.c = Me.a
	Me= Me.b
Case "Müdür Yardımcısı"
	Me.a.Value = "0"
	Me.d.Value = "18"
	Me.f.Value = "0"
	Me.g.Value = "0"
	Me.c = Me.a
	Me= Me.b
Case "Ücretli Öğretmen"
	Me.a.Value = "0"
	Me.d.Value = "0"
	Me.f.Value = "0"
	Me.g.Value = "0"
	Me.c = Me.a
	Me= Me.b
Case "Öğretmen"
    If Me.mkod = "Rehber Öğretmen" Then
		Me.a.Value = "0"
		Me.d.Value = "18"
		Me.f.Value = "0"
		Me.g.Value = "0"
		Me.c = Me.a
		Me= Me.b
    ElseIf Me.mkod = "Sınıf Öğretmenliği" Then
		Me.a.Value = "18"
		Me.d.Value = "0"
		Me.f.Value = "3"
		Me.g.Value = "0"
		Me.c = Me.a
		Me= Me.b
    ElseIf Me.mkod = "Okul Öncesi" Then
		Me.a.Value = "18"
		Me.d.Value = "0"
		Me.f.Value = "3"
		Me.g.Value = "0"
		Me.c = Me.a
		Me= Me.b
    Else
		Me.a.Value = "15"
		Me.d.Value = "0"
		Me.f.Value = "2"
		Me.c = Me.a
		Me= Me.b
  
		If Me.c.Value + Me.ç.Value = "30" Then
			Me.g.Value = "3"
		ElseIf Me.c + Me>= 20 And Me.c + Me<= 29 Then
			Me.g.Value = "2"
		ElseIf Me.c + Me>= 10 And Me.c + Me<= 19 Then
			Me.g.Value = "1"
		Else
			Me.g.Value = "0"
		End If
    End If
End Select
j = ç + d + e + f + g + ğ + h + ı + i

Me.a.Requery
Me.b.Requery
Me.c.Requery
Me.ç.Requery
Me.d.Requery
Me.f.Requery
Me.g.Requery
Me.j.Requery
End Sub


dana sonra Ünvan, mkod ve b metin kutularının çıkıldığında olayına

Visual Basic Code
Call Hesapla

kodu ekleyin.

birkaç ders ve ünvan denedim problem gözükmüyor.

Deneyip bilgi veriniz.


"Boş Örnek Eklerim, Yapıp Verirler" demeyin, örneğinizi hazırlayın.
Komplike kod talebiniz var ise İletişim bağlantısından bize ulaşın. 
Cebelleşmezsen Öğrenemezsin. 

Kullanici Avatari

kursad05

Kendi halinde...
Aktif Üye
KÜ.... KA....
 40
99
12/02/2009
0
Amasya
Ofis 2013 64 Bit
03/05/2018,15:23
Çözüldü 
Hocam ben bu verdiğiniz kodları nereye yazacağım? Tüm kodları silip yapıştırdım olmadı. Modül olarak yaptım yine olmadı. yapıştırdığım zaman hepsi kırmızı renkte oluyorlar.


Gün gelecek herkes beni ve Access'i anlayacak!!!

Kullanici Avatari

ozanakkaya

sledgeab
Kurucu
OZ.... AK....
 40
10.963
29/01/2008
Denizli
Memur
Ofis 2010 32 Bit
Bugün,00:25
Çözüldü 
"Ücret Onayı alt2" formunun vb sayfasını aç, option compare database harici hepsini sil, Sub Hesapla() kodunu yapıştır.

Ek Dosyalar
ücretonayı2003_sled.rar
[126.21 KB]


"Boş Örnek Eklerim, Yapıp Verirler" demeyin, örneğinizi hazırlayın.
Komplike kod talebiniz var ise İletişim bağlantısından bize ulaşın. 
Cebelleşmezsen Öğrenemezsin. 


Konuyu Okuyanlar: 1 Ziyaretçi

Konu ile Alakalı Benzer Konular
Konular Yazar Yorumlar Okunma Son Yorum
Çözüldü Formdan Forma Veri Aktarmak m_demir 2 75 13/07/2018, 10:36
Son Yorum: m_demir
Çözüldü Sürekli Formda Filtreleme Sorunu mmert06 4 131 01/07/2018, 19:32
Son Yorum: mmert06
Çözüldü 2013 Access runtime güvenlik sorunu sertac76 16 2.385 21/06/2018, 15:21
Son Yorum: ozanakkaya
Çözüldü Formda Resim Yoksa Hata Sorunu fascioğlu 11 241 31/05/2018, 16:45
Son Yorum: fascioğlu
Çözüldü Liste Kutusu Güncelleme Sorunu murat dikme 4 109 31/05/2018, 14:33
Son Yorum: murat dikme

Türkçe Çeviri: MCTR, Yazılım: MyBB, © 2002-2018 MyBB Group.